UK ISP Quickline, which is building a new gigabit-capable full fibre (FTTP) broadband network across parts of England, has announced that their network has just gone live across three new villages – Burton, Navenby and Metheringham – in rural Lincolnshire (total of over 2,000 extra premises passed).
